Abstract
This study present a three phase grid fed photovoltaic system based on a maximum power point tracking, which act as the maximum particle swarm optimization. The solar system fed to the grid needs additional conditions to get from a large quality electric system. The work introduces connection of three phase fed solar system. Therefore the boost converter system with maximum power point (MPSO,MPPT) is applied to utilize the maximum power get from the solar and modify them to the utility grid. A complete simulation and installation of a three phase grid-fed inverter are modelled to analyse the proposed novel controller for the utility grid connected solar PV system.
